Thanks for taking time to comment, Jas.

Agree with you on all your points. For picture 1 the background was purposely left that way as I was trying out different effects with different background. All 3 pictures were taken at about the same time in the day, and the background for pic 1 was the natural one. I blocked off part of the sun light to create the darker background for pic 2. For pic 3, I actually wanted the blown out upper right corner to contrast with the darker lower left corner, but guess I over done it. I perfers pic 2 over the others too.
